What "Free Domain" Actually Means

Before comparing hosts, understand exactly what is (and is not) included in a free domain offer.

What IS included

  • First year of domain registration (typically .co.uk, .uk, or .com)
  • DNS management through your hosting control panel
  • Full ownership — you can transfer the domain to another registrar
  • WHOIS privacy included free by some hosts (IONOS, Bluehost, DreamHost)

What to watch out for

  • Domain renewal after year one (£8–18/year depending on extension)
  • WHOIS privacy sometimes charged extra (£3–10/year)
  • 60-day transfer lock on new domains (ICANN policy, not provider-specific)
  • Premium extensions (.io, .dev, .london) usually not covered

Free Domain Hosting — Frequently Asked Questions

Which UK hosting providers include a free domain?
Nine providers in our comparison include free domain registration: IONOS, HostArmada, Bluehost, DreamHost, HostPapa, Flashcloud, InMotion Hosting, Fasthosts, and 123 Reg. The domain is typically free for the first year and covers .co.uk, .uk, or .com extensions depending on the provider.
Is the free domain really free, or are there hidden costs?
The domain registration itself is genuinely free for the first year on all nine providers we list. However, be aware of two costs: (1) domain renewal after year one, which typically ranges from £8-15/year, and (2) WHOIS privacy protection, which some providers charge extra for (£3-10/year). IONOS, Bluehost, and DreamHost include WHOIS privacy free.
What happens to my free domain after the first year?
After the first year, your domain renews at the provider's standard domain renewal rate — typically £8-15/year for .co.uk and £10-18/year for .com. This is standard across the industry. You can also transfer your domain to a cheaper registrar (like Dynadot or EuroDNS) after the first year if you prefer to keep costs down.
Can I transfer my free domain to another registrar?
Yes, but usually only after 60 days (ICANN transfer lock period). Most hosts will provide an EPP/transfer code on request. Be aware that some providers make it slightly harder to transfer out — but they cannot legally prevent it. Budget around £8-12 for the transfer fee at the receiving registrar.
Which free domain extensions are included?
Most UK hosts offering free domains include .co.uk, .uk, and .com. Some also cover .org and .net. Premium extensions like .io or .london are typically not included in free domain offers. IONOS offers the widest selection of free extensions, while Fasthosts and 123 Reg focus on .co.uk and .uk.
Is it better to buy hosting and domain separately?
For beginners, bundled hosting + domain is simpler and cheaper in year one. The free domain saves you £5-15. However, advanced users may prefer buying domains separately from a specialist registrar (better transfer tools, more extensions, often cheaper renewals). Either approach works — the key is comparing the total first-year cost including domain.
